@uipath/case-tool

CLI plugin for managing UiPath case management resources. Provides commands to pull, cache, and list resources from the UiPath platform.

Installation

This package is a plugin for uip. It is loaded automatically when installed in the CLI's plugin directory.

Prerequisites

You must be logged in before using any commands:

uip login

Commands

All commands are available under the case prefix:

uip maestro case <command>

registry pull

Fetch and cache all resource types from the UiPath platform.

uip maestro case registry pull [options]
OptionDescription
-f, --forceForce refresh, ignore local cache
-s, --solutionId <id>Include entities from a specific solution
--output <type>Output format: json, table, yaml, plain (default: json)

Resource types pulled:

TypeDescription
agentAgent processes
processRPA workflows
apiAPI workflows
processOrchestrationAgentic processes
caseManagementCase management workflows
typecache-activitiesConnector activities (Integration Service)
typecache-triggersConnector triggers (Integration Service)
action-appsDeployed human action apps
solutionSolution entities (requires --solutionId)

Cache behavior: Results are cached for 30 minutes in ~/.uip/case-resources/. Subsequent pull calls within that window return cached data unless --force is passed.

Example output:

{
  "Result": "Success",
  "Code": "PullResourcesSuccess",
  "Data": {
    "TotalNodesCount": 142,
    "FromCache": false,
    "ResourceTypes": [
      { "Type": "agent", "NodesCount": 12, "FromCache": false, "CacheWritten": true },
      { "Type": "process", "NodesCount": 87, "FromCache": false, "CacheWritten": true }
    ]
  }
}

Search for resources by keyword and/or structured field filters.

uip maestro case registry search [keyword] [options]
OptionDescription
-t, --type <type>Limit search to a specific resource type (see types above)
-f, --filter <filter>Field filters, e.g. name:contains=Apple,category=Pipelines
--output <type>Output format: json, table, yaml, plain

Filter syntax:

field=value                   equality (default)
field:contains=value          field contains value
field:startsWith=value        field starts with value
field:endsWith=value          field ends with value
field:in=value1|value2        field matches any of the values
field1=v1,field2=v2           multiple conditions (AND logic)

Filterable fields: name, description, category, tags

Examples:

# Search connectors by keyword
uip maestro case registry search outlook --type typecache-activities

# Filter by category
uip maestro case registry search --filter "category:contains=Salesforce" --type typecache-activities

# Search across all resource types
uip maestro case registry search "send email"

registry get

Get a resource by its identifier. For connector activities and triggers, automatically enriches the result with input/output field metadata from Integration Service.

uip maestro case registry get <identifier> [options]
Argument/OptionDescription
<identifier>entityKey (process-types), id (action-apps), or uiPathActivityTypeId (connectors)
--connection-id <id>Connection ID for connection-specific IS field metadata (custom fields). Only applies to typecache-activities / typecache-triggers results.
--output <type>Output format: json, table, yaml, plain

Connector enrichment: When the matched resource is a typecache-activities or typecache-triggers entry, the result is automatically enriched with inputDefinition and outputDefinition fields fetched from Integration Service. These describe the available input/output fields for that connector activity, including field types, required flags, descriptions, and enum values.

  • Without --connection-id: returns standard/base fields for the connector object.
  • With --connection-id: returns connection-specific fields including custom fields tied to that account.

If Integration Service is unavailable or the activity has no associated IS object (non-curated), the resource is returned as-is without enrichment.

Examples:

# Get a connector activity with IS field metadata
uip maestro case registry get 696568b6-0a38-3a97-8831-38e3cf3588fa

# Get with connection-specific custom fields
uip maestro case registry get 696568b6-0a38-3a97-8831-38e3cf3588fa --connection-id <your-connection-id>

# Get an agent by entityKey
uip maestro case registry get my-agent-entity-key

registry list

List all locally cached resources.

uip maestro case registry list [options]
OptionDescription
--output <type>Output format: json, table, yaml, plain (default: json)
-q, --quietQuiet mode, no output

If no cache exists, the command automatically fetches live data from the platform.

validate

Validate a case management definition JSON file against all case management rules (structure, stages, edges, conditions).

uip maestro case validate <file>

Returns a list of errors and warnings. Exits with code 1 if any errors are found.

cases

Manage local case management definition JSON files.

uip maestro case cases <action>
SubcommandDescription
addCreate a new case management definition JSON file
update <file>Update root-level properties of an existing definition
validate <file>Validate a definition file (alias for uip maestro case validate)

cases add options:

OptionDescription
-n, --name <name>Name of the case management definition (required)
-f, --file <path>Output path for the new JSON file (required)
--case-identifier <id>Case identifier string (defaults to name)
--identifier-type <type>constant or external (default: constant)
--case-app-enabledEnable the case app for this definition

cases update options:

OptionDescription
-n, --name <name>New name
--case-identifier <id>New case identifier
--identifier-type <type>New identifier type
--case-app-enabledEnable the case app

stages

Manage stage nodes within a case management definition JSON file.

uip maestro case stages <action> <file> [stage-id]
SubcommandDescription
add <file>Add a new stage node
update <file> <stage-id>Update an existing stage's label
get <file> <stage-id>Print a stage and its connected edges
remove <file> <stage-id>Remove a stage and its connected edges

stages add options:

OptionDescription
-l, --label <label>Display label for the stage
-t, --type <type>stage, exception, or trigger (default: stage)

edges

Manage edges within a case management definition JSON file.

uip maestro case edges <action> <file> [edge-id]
SubcommandDescription
add <file>Add a new edge between two nodes
update <file> <edge-id>Update an existing edge
get <file> <edge-id>Print an edge
remove <file> <edge-id>Remove an edge
validate <file> <edge-id>Validate a single edge in context
list <file>List all edges in a definition

edges add options:

OptionDescription
-s, --source <id>Source stage or trigger ID (required)
-t, --target <id>Target stage ID (required)
-l, --label <label>Display label
--source-handle <dir>right, left, top, bottom (default: right)
--target-handle <dir>right, left, top, bottom (default: left)
--z-index <number>Z-index layer for rendering order

Edge type is inferred from the source node: Trigger → TriggerEdge, Stage → Edge.

edges validate checks:

  • Source and target nodes exist
  • No duplicate conditions on edges from the same source node

Local Cache

Resources are stored in ~/.uip/case-resources/ as JSON files:

FileContents
{type}-index.jsonFull resource array for that type
{type}-index.meta.jsonSync metadata: lastSync, count, hash

Change detection uses SHA-256 hashing — if the fetched data is identical to the cache, only the timestamp is updated and the index is not rewritten.
